h41msh1c0r
Goto Top

Excel Summe und WVerweis kombinieren?

Aloa,

Quelltabelle
A	B	C  
1	0	0
2	0	4
3	2	1

Zieltabelle
A	6
B	2
C	5

Mit WVerweis bekomme ich ja die richtige Spalte raus.
Aber wie bekomme ich die Summe der Spalte hin ohne mit Hilfszellen zu arbeiten?

VG

Content-ID: 668257

Url: https://administrator.de/contentid/668257

Printed on: October 15, 2024 at 07:10 o'clock

ukulele-7
ukulele-7 Sep 19, 2024 at 14:43:47 (UTC)
Goto Top
Du kannst im SVERWEIS Spalten als Variable angeben, du kannst aber mit SVERWEIS keine Spalte finden. Finden tust du Zeilen bzw. eigentlich eine Zelle aus der Zeile mit deinem Suchwert.
H41mSh1C0R
H41mSh1C0R Sep 19, 2024 updated at 14:49:16 (UTC)
Goto Top
WVERWEIS(Suchkriterium;Matrix;Zeilenindex;[Bereich_Verweis])

Wenn ich also nach

WVerweis("B"; A1:A3;1) müsste das doch wahr sein oder?
ukulele-7
ukulele-7 Sep 19, 2024 at 14:49:59 (UTC)
Goto Top
Ah okay, sry falsch gelesen.
ukulele-7
ukulele-7 Sep 19, 2024 at 14:58:14 (UTC)
Goto Top
Dein Suchbereich A1:A3 ist aber komisch. In der Quelltabelle liegen die Werte A; 1 und 2 da drin, kein B. WVERWEIS findet also kein B und nimmt das erst Beste, was kommt. Ergebnis ist A.

Warum gibt die Excel WVERWEIS Funktion einen falschen Wert zurück?
Wenn Du für den Funktionsparameter Bereich_Verweis keinen Wert definiert hast, dann wird automatisch WAHR angenommen. Das entspricht der sogenannten ungefähren Übereinstimmung und kann zu fehlerhaften Ergebnissen führen. Du solltest die erste Zeile der Suchmatrix auf jeden Falls alphabetisch oder numerisch sortieren. Sortiere also die erste Zeile oder wende den Parameter FALSCH an, damit die WVERWEIS Funktion nach dem exakten Inhalt sucht, so wie es im Suchkriterium definiert ist. In den meisten Anwendungsfällen wird nach einem exakten Wert gesucht, wähle daher den Wert FALSCH für Bereich_Verweis.
https://albertexcel.com/funktionen/verweise/excel-wverweis-funktion/
Kraemer
Kraemer Sep 19, 2024 at 14:59:47 (UTC)
Goto Top
=WVERWEIS("B";A1:C4;4;FALSCH)  
ergibt 2
Blackmann
Blackmann Sep 19, 2024 updated at 15:07:06 (UTC)
Goto Top
=WVERWEIS(A1;$A$1:$C$4;1)

Matrix ist die gesamte Tabelle
Zeielindex ist die Nr des zurückgegebenden gewünschten Ergebnisses

@Kraemer, den Ergebnis, die '2', ist der Inhalt des Feldes B4,

Aber ich verstehe die Frage nicht so recht, Freitag?
Also was soll das Ziel sein
ukulele-7
ukulele-7 Sep 19, 2024 at 15:03:05 (UTC)
Goto Top
Mit
=WVERWEIS("B"; A1:C1;1;FALSCH)
findest du B oder eine Zelle unterhalb von B, die du mit dem Zeilenindex angeben kannst.

Willst du jetzt die Summe aller Werte unterhalb von B wird es schwierig, das kann man nicht allein über WVERWEIS lösen. Du findest ja auch keine Zell-Koordninate, die du in eine Summenformel einsetzen könntest, sondern den Wert in einer Zelle. Du müsstest in deiner Quell-Tabelle eine Summen-Zeile haben, z.B. an zweiter Stelle, die für alle Spalten die Summe zieht. Dann kannst du mit

=WVERWEIS("B"; A1:C1;2;FALSCH)
auf die Summe zugreifen.
Ted555
Solution Ted555 Sep 19, 2024 updated at 15:29:09 (UTC)
Goto Top
=SUMME(BEREICH.VERSCHIEBEN($A$2:$A$4;0;VERGLEICH(A6;$A$1:$C$1;0)-1))

screenshot
H41mSh1C0R
H41mSh1C0R Sep 20, 2024 updated at 04:28:43 (UTC)
Goto Top
Zitat von @Ted555:

=SUMME(BEREICH.VERSCHIEBEN($A$2:$A$4;0;VERGLEICH(A6;$A$1:$C$1;0)-1))

screenshot

Guten Morgen,

Dass ist genau die Lösung, danke.

VG